How they compare

Croatia currently reports 1.73 billion US dollar against 1.29 billion US dollar in Nepal, a difference of 440.07 million US dollar.

That makes Croatia's figure about 1.3 times Nepal's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 13 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Nepal ahead.

Croatia ranks 55th and Nepal ranks 58th of 160 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Croatia averaged higher in 1 and Nepal in 1.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
